Our goal is always to reach and engage as many people as possible. When reacting to our posts, “Love” (heart emoji) will garner a higher rate of engagement than “Like” (thumbs up emoji), though it is not necessary to “Love” every post of ours. To do so, put your mouse over “Like” on a post, and click the “Heart” emoji.

Commenting garners more engagement than a react emoji. To comment, simply type in the box under the post where it says, “Write a comment.” A quick comment on a CAF could be something as simple as “creative jewelry” or “beautiful pottery”.

A Share is the highest form of engagement on Facebook. Simply click Share on the bottom of the post and the select “Share”. When Sharing any of our content, it’s best to write a few words of your own, such as, “This is great!”, “WOW!”, or “Check out this artisan’s website”.

Interacting with our posts shows Facebook that our page and posts are relevant and worthy of sending out to many others. The more we all react, comment and share, the more people will know what is going on in the Calvert Arts Festival world, as well as what's happening at All Saints'.
